Bachelor’s degree in Civil, Architectural, Environmental Engineering, or other engineering/NASA-equivalent technical field.
Minimum GPA 3.0/4.0 in undergrad (≈ 75%).
Subject Prerequisites: Foundation in strength of materials, fluid mechanics, structural analysis, and environmental/water resources.
Proficiency in mathematics—particularly calculus and differential equations.
Coursework in statistics, soil/rock mechanics, hydraulics, or surveying is a plus.
